About Edmundo Rubio

Edmundo Rubio is a scholar working on Microbiology,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, having authored 37 papers that have together received 279 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Tracheal and airway disorders (12 papers), Medical Imaging and Pathology Studies (5 papers) and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ia detection and treatment (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(37 citations),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(29 citations) and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(127 citations). Edmundo Rubio has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and Nepal. Frequent co-authors include Michael Boyd, Ralph E. Whatley, Harold M. Szerlip, Douglas J. Grider, Kevin L. Kovitz, Brijesh B. Patel, Jorge Aguilar, Sheila Bheddah, Marybeth A. Pysz and Wade Anderson.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, CHEST Journal and The Annals of Thoracic Surgery.
